> Subject: Quick Questions on some Tomcat settings
> With that in mind, can I:
> Have tomcat serve on port 80 (bound to a different IP address than the
> Apache 2.2 installation) on the same machine, and when 'this-name' is
> entered into the web browser, it will serve it?
Yes.
> Would this be in the virtual hosting section of the documentation
> by chance?
Probably not. All you need to do is set the address attribute of the <Connector> elements(s)
in conf/server.xml. By default, each <Connector> listens on 0.0.0.0 (or IPv6 equivalent),
and you don't want that in your case.
